Academic Overview

Luzerne County Community College is a public, 2-4 years institute located in Nanticoke, Pennsylvania. It is an Associate's - Public Special Use by Carnegie Classification and its highest degree is Associate's degree.
The 2023 tuition & fees is $10,530 for Pennsylvania residents and $15,060 for out-of-state students. The school offers only undergraduate programs and a total of 4,187 students are enrolled.
The salary after graduation from Luzerne County Community College varies by major programs where the average earning after 10 years is $35,200. You can check the average salary by the major programs on the area of study page.

Key Academic Statistics

The following chart illustrates the 2023 key academic statistics at Luzerne County CC.
The average received amount of financial aid is $3,795 and 55% of undergraduate students received grants or scholarship aid. A total of 4,187 students is attending , and the student to faculty ratio is 15 to 1.
